Medical.library@ 336-832-7496Why Not Only Rely on Google or Other Resources on the Internet?Although Google, Google Scholar, and other Web sites or resources on the Internet might seem easier and at your fingertips, they are not the best sources for finding comprehensive evidence to guide clinical practice. Sources on the Internet may not be appropriately referenced or scientific; in addition, the author may not be the most reputable.1,2 Anyone can add to Wikipedia or create a Web site. Hence, although they are accessible 24 hours a day/7 days a week and somewhat easier to use, they should only be used after careful evaluation and only be one of the sources that are used for a good comprehensive search of the health care literature.11,12 It is also important to remember that unless the site is regularly updated (daily is best), the information on a Web site can easily become outdated. In addition, because of the way the World Wide Web is financed, the results that come up first in a search can be related to the advertising and not the most important to your search. If you are going to use materials from the Web, it is important to evaluate them appropriately. Find out who wrote the information. Are they an appropriate expert in the field of interest? Are there disclosures on the Web site? Do they tell you their affiliations or reveal their conflicts of interest? The Web is often a source of merchandize, so it is important to understand the purpose of the materials on a Web site that you use for your search. Do they tell you how current the research they report is? Knowing the answers to these questions will be helpful in understanding how much you will want to rely on these materials as being unbiased and useful in your search or not.1,2Table and Excerpt from Jacqueline M. Aged ( > 80 yrs.)Understand the Literature - Types of StudiesThe table below describes the different types of studies you will come across.Type Of StudyDefinitionMore InformationSystematic ReviewA document often written by a panel that provides a comprehensive review of all relevant studies on a particular clinical or health-related topic or question. The systematic review is created after reviewing and combining all the information from both published and unpublished studies (focusing on clinical trials of similar treatments) and then summarizing the findings. Pros/Cons & ExamplesNOTE: There’s a distinction between a “Review” article and the more rigorous, detailed and transparent “Systematic Review” Randomized Controlled Trial (RCT)A study design that randomly assigns participants into an experimental group or a control group. As the study is conducted, the only expected difference between the control and experimental groups in a randomized controlled trial (RCT) is the outcome variable being studied. Pros/Cons & ExamplesCohort StudyA study design where one or more samples (called cohorts) are followed prospectively and subsequent status evaluations with respect to a disease or outcome are conducted to determine which initial participants exposure characteristics (risk factors) are associated with it. As the study is conducted, outcome from participants in each cohort is measured and relationships with specific characteristics determinedPros/Cons & ExamplesCase Control or Retrospective StudyA study that compares patients who have a disease or outcome of interest (cases) with patients who do not have the disease or outcome (controls), and looks back retrospectively to compare how frequently the exposure to a risk factor is present in each group to determine the relationship between the risk factor and the disease. Pros/Cons & ExamplesCase ReportAn article that describes and interprets an individual case, often written in the form of a detailed story. What Level of Confidence Should I Have in This Article?STUDY DESIGNQUALITYINITIAL CONFIDENCESystematic Review (SR) Pros/Cons & ExamplesA type of comprehensive literature review that uses systematic methods to collect all available relevant research on a specific topic, critically appraise the research studies, and synthesize their findings. BestHIGHEST ARandomized Controlled Trial (RCT) Pros/Cons & ExamplesA study in which people are allocated at random (by chance alone) to receive one of several clinical interventions. One of these interventions is the standard of comparison or control.Very GoodA-Cohort Studies Pros/Cons & ExamplesAn observational study where samples (cohorts) are followed and characteristics (risk factors) are studied to estimate how often disease or life events (e.g. incidence rate, relative risk or absolute risk) happen in a certain population. GoodB+Case Control/Retrospective Pros/Cons & ExamplesA study that looks back in time to find the relative risk between a specific exposure (e.g. secondhand tobacco smoke) and an outcome (e.g. cancer). A control group of people who do not have the disease or who did not experience the event is used for comparison.FairBCase Report Pros/Cons & ExamplesA detailed report of the symptoms, signs, diagnosis, treatment, and follow-up of an individual patient. Case reports may contain a demographic profile of the patient, but usually describe an unusual or novel occurrence.PoorB-OpinionBased on the author’s clinical experience and expertise.
